9. GLOBAL PRIVACY CONTROL
Global Privacy Control ("GPC") is a browser-based privacy preference signal that may communicate a user's request to opt out of certain sale, sharing, or targeted-advertising activities.
Where required by applicable law and in regions where applicable data-sharing opt-out functionality is enabled, OREVYNA uses Shopify's customer privacy functionality to process qualifying GPC signals.
A GPC signal generally applies to the browser or device from which the signal is sent.
If you use multiple browsers or devices, you may need to enable GPC separately for each browser or device.
